[Remote] Key Account Manager – Independent Wholesale Distribution (Remote)
Note: The job is a remote job and is open to candidates in USA. Trane Technologies is a world leader in creating sustainable climate solutions. They are seeking a Key Account Manager for Independent Wholesale Distribution who will drive growth and profitability within the HVAC supply sales channel by developing and executing national distributor growth strategies.
